How they compare
El Salvador currently reports 2.11 ratio against 2.06 ratio in Armenia, a difference of 0.05 ratio.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was El Salvador ahead.
Armenia ranks 131st and El Salvador ranks 129th of 172 countries.
Armenia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Armenia | El Salvador |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 3.88 ratio | 3.71 ratio | 0.165 ratio | Armenia |
| 2010s | 4.13 ratio | 3.13 ratio | 1 ratio | Armenia |
| 2020s | 3.98 ratio | 2.2 ratio | 1.77 ratio | Armenia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
